The Overall Health Score in 46140, Greenfield, Indiana is 52 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

88.63 percent of the population in 46140 drive to work alone. 0.00 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 58.16 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 4.37 percent of the residents in 46140 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 2.43 members with about 2.21 cars available per household.

An estimate of 92.94 percent of the residents in 46140 has some form of health insurance. 30.03 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 76.99 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.

A resident in 46140 would have to travel an average of 1.17 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, HANCOCK REGIONAL HOSPITAL . In a 20-mile radius, there are 4,814 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 46140, Greenfield, Indiana.

As of , an estimate of 41,214 residents live in 46140 with a median age of 39.5 years. 21.77 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 17.77 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 40.03 percent of the residents in 46140 is currently married, and 16.94 percent of the population has never been married.

The monthly median household income in 46140 is $7,255.67.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 46140 is approximately $1,000. The median household spends about 13.78 percent of their income on housing.

Greenfield, Indiana, is a vibrant and growing community located in Hancock County. With a population of over 30,000 residents, Greenfield offers a welcoming environment with a strong focus on healthcare amenities and accessibility.

One of the standout healthcare facilities in Greenfield is Hancock Health, a leading provider of healthcare services in the area. Hancock Health offers a comprehensive range of services including primary care, specialty care, surgical services, and emergency care. The facility is equipped with state-of-the-art technology and staffed by skilled healthcare professionals, ensuring that residents have access to high-quality medical care close to home.

In addition to Hancock Health, Greenfield is also home to several other medical clinics and specialist offices, providing residents with a variety of healthcare options to meet their needs. This includes family medicine practices, dental offices, physical therapy centers, and more.

In addition to its robust healthcare amenities, Greenfield offers a rich history that adds to the appeal of the area for potential movers. Founded in 1828 and named after John Green, an early settler in the region, Greenfield has grown from its agricultural roots into a thriving community with a strong emphasis on quality of life for its residents.
